Xylem is hiring a Sales Manager for their commercial treatment business in Canada!

The Sales Manager is a senior-level position responsible for leading complex sales projects and initiatives in the water industry. This role involves identifying and pursuing high-value sales opportunities, conducting advanced sales presentations, and developing strategies to improve sales performance. The Sales Manager works closely with cross-functional teams to address customer needs, implement corrective actions, and ensure compliance with regulatory requirements. Additionally, this role involves mentoring and training junior sales staff and providing technical expertise to support continuous improvement efforts.
This position covers all of Canada, and the ideal candidate will be based in Canada. The successful candidate will be responsible for selling into municipal wastewater and drinking water facilities across the region. Bilingual proficiency in English and French is preferred, but not required.

Xylem |ˈzīləm| 1) The tissue in plants that brings water upward from the roots; 2) a leading global water technology company. Xylem, a leading global water technology company dedicated to solving the world’s most challenging water issues, is the leading global provider of efficient, innovative and sustainable water technologies improving the way water is used, managed, conserved and re-used.
